Environmental Concerns (approx. 100 words): Sand mining has become a widespread practice globally, adversely affecting ecosystems and freshwater sources. India is no exception, as it grapples with the rampant extraction of sand from riverbeds and coastal areas, resulting in the depletion of these valuable resources. Furthermore, unregulated mining leads to increased riverbank erosion, loss of biodiversity, and disruption of aquatic ecosystems. The excessive sand extraction also contributes to land degradation, exacerbating the risks of floods and coastal erosion.

The Role of Sand Crushers (approx. 100 words): In response to these environmental challenges, innovative sand crushers have emerged as a sustainable solution in India. A sand crusher is a revolutionary technology that significantly reduces the use of natural sand by grinding down hard rocks into fine, angular particles. These crushed sand particles possess similar properties to river sand, making them an optimal alternative for construction purposes. By curbing the reliance on riverbed sand, sand crushers alleviate the pressure on water bodies and preserve the delicate ecological balance.
